Online calculator, figures and tables showing heat of vaporization of water, at temperatures from 0 - 370 °C (32 - 700 °F) - SI and Imperial units
The (latent) heat of vaporization (∆Hvap) also known as the enthalpy of vaporization or evaporation, is the amount of energy (enthalpy) that must be added to a liquid substance, totransform a given quantity of the substance into a gas.
The enthalpy of vaporization is a function of the pressure at which that transformation takes place. The heat of vaporization diminishes with increasing temperature and it vanishes completely at a certain point called the critical temperature (Critical temperature for water: 373.946 °C or 705.103 °F, Critical pressure: 220.6 bar = 22.06 MPa = 3200 psi ).

Heat of vaporization for liquid water at saturation pressure at temperatures from 0 to 374 °C:
Temperature | Vapor pressure | Heat of vaporization, ∆Hvap | |||
[°C] | [kPa] [100*bar] | [J/mol] | [kJ/kg] | [Wh/kg] | [Btu(IT)/lbm] |
0.01 | 0.61165 | 45054 | 2500.9 | 694.69 | 1075.2 |
2 | 0.70599 | 44970 | 2496.2 | 693.39 | 1073.2 |
4 | 0.81355 | 44883 | 2491.4 | 692.06 | 1071.1 |
10 | 1.2282 | 44627 | 2477.2 | 688.11 | 1065.0 |
14 | 1.5990 | 44456 | 2467.7 | 685.47 | 1060.9 |
18 | 2.0647 | 44287 | 2458.3 | 682.86 | 1056.9 |
20 | 2.3393 | 44200 | 2453.5 | 681.53 | 1054.8 |
25 | 3.1699 | 43988 | 2441.7 | 678.25 | 1049.7 |
30 | 4.2470 | 43774 | 2429.8 | 674.94 | 1044.6 |
34 | 5.3251 | 43602 | 2420.3 | 672.31 | 1040.5 |
40 | 7.3849 | 43345 | 2406.0 | 668.33 | 1034.4 |
44 | 9.1124 | 43172 | 2396.4 | 665.67 | 1030.3 |
50 | 12.352 | 42911 | 2381.9 | 661.64 | 1024.0 |
54 | 15.022 | 42738 | 2372.3 | 658.97 | 1019.9 |
60 | 19.946 | 42475 | 2357.7 | 654.92 | 1013.6 |
70 | 31.201 | 42030 | 2333.0 | 648.06 | 1003.0 |
80 | 47.414 | 41579 | 2308.0 | 641.11 | 992.26 |
90 | 70.182 | 41120 | 2282.5 | 634.03 | 981.30 |
96 | 87.771 | 40839 | 2266.9 | 629.69 | 974.59 |
100 | 101.42 | 40650 | 2256.4 | 626.78 | 970.08 |
110 | 143.38 | 40167 | 2229.6 | 619.33 | 958.56 |
120 | 198.67 | 39671 | 2202.1 | 611.69 | 946.73 |
140 | 361.54 | 38630 | 2144.3 | 595.64 | 921.88 |
160 | 618.23 | 37508 | 2082.0 | 578.33 | 895.10 |
180 | 1002.8 | 36286 | 2014.2 | 559.50 | 865.95 |
200 | 1554.9 | 34944 | 1939.7 | 538.81 | 833.92 |
220 | 2319.6 | 33462 | 1857.4 | 515.94 | 798.54 |
240 | 3346.9 | 31804 | 1765.4 | 490.39 | 758.99 |
260 | 4692.3 | 29934 | 1661.6 | 461.56 | 714.36 |
280 | 6416.6 | 27798 | 1543.0 | 428.61 | 663.37 |
300 | 8587.9 | 25304 | 1404.6 | 390.17 | 603.87 |
320 | 11284 | 22310 | 1238.4 | 344.00 | 532.42 |
340 | 14601 | 18507 | 1027.3 | 285.36 | 441.66 |
360 | 18666 | 12967 | 719.8 | 199.9 | 309.5 |
373.946 | 22064 | 0 | 0.0 | 0.0 | 0.0 |
Heat of vaporization for liquid water at saturation pressure at temperatures from 0 to 705 °F:
Temperature | Vapor pressure | Heat of vaporization, ∆Hvap | |||
[°F] | [psi] | [Btu(IT)/mol] | [Btu(IT)/lbm] | [cal/g] | [kJ/kg] |
32.2 | 0.0891 | 42.70 | 1075.2 | 597.33 | 2500.9 |
40 | 0.1219 | 42.52 | 1070.7 | 594.82 | 2490.4 |
50 | 0.1783 | 42.30 | 1065.0 | 591.67 | 2477.2 |
60 | 0.2564 | 42.07 | 1059.4 | 588.54 | 2464.1 |
70 | 0.3632 | 41.85 | 1053.7 | 585.39 | 2450.9 |
80 | 0.5073 | 41.62 | 1048.0 | 582.25 | 2437.7 |
90 | 0.6990 | 41.40 | 1042.4 | 579.09 | 2424.5 |
100 | 0.9506 | 41.17 | 1036.7 | 575.92 | 2411.3 |
110 | 1.277 | 40.95 | 1030.9 | 572.74 | 2398.0 |
120 | 1.695 | 40.72 | 1025.2 | 569.55 | 2384.6 |
130 | 2.226 | 40.49 | 1019.4 | 566.34 | 2371.2 |
140 | 2.893 | 40.26 | 1013.6 | 563.13 | 2357.7 |
150 | 3.723 | 40.02 | 1007.7 | 559.86 | 2344.0 |
160 | 4.747 | 39.79 | 1001.8 | 556.58 | 2330.3 |
170 | 6.000 | 39.55 | 995.87 | 553.26 | 2316.4 |
180 | 7.519 | 39.31 | 989.85 | 549.92 | 2302.4 |
190 | 9.350 | 39.07 | 983.76 | 546.54 | 2288.2 |
200 | 11.54 | 38.83 | 977.60 | 543.11 | 2273.9 |
210 | 14.14 | 38.58 | 971.35 | 539.64 | 2259.4 |
212 | 14.71 | 38.53 | 970.08 | 538.93 | 2256.4 |
220 | 17.20 | 38.33 | 965.02 | 536.12 | 2244.6 |
240 | 24.99 | 37.81 | 952.05 | 528.92 | 2214.5 |
260 | 35.45 | 37.28 | 938.64 | 521.46 | 2183.3 |
280 | 49.22 | 36.73 | 924.71 | 513.73 | 2150.9 |
300 | 66.6 | 36.15 | 910.21 | 505.67 | 2117.1 |
350 | 135 | 34.59 | 870.97 | 483.87 | 2025.9 |
400 | 247 | 32.82 | 826.41 | 459.12 | 1922.2 |
450 | 422 | 30.78 | 774.93 | 430.51 | 1802.5 |
500 | 680 | 28.37 | 714.36 | 396.87 | 1661.6 |
550 | 1044 | 25.48 | 641.56 | 356.42 | 1492.3 |
600 | 1541 | 21.93 | 552.09 | 306.72 | 1284.2 |
625 | 1849 | 19.41 | 488.64 | 271.46 | 1136.6 |
650 | 2205 | 16.95 | 426.81 | 237.11 | 992.8 |
675 | 2615 | 13.47 | 339.22 | 188.46 | 789.0 |
705.103 | 3196 | 0.00 | 0.00 | 0.00 | 0.0 |
